The Adapt Ladies Open was a women's professional golf tournament on the Swedish Golf Tour, played between 1996 and 1998. It was always held in Uppsala, Sweden. Played at Upsala Golf Club, the club had previous experience hosting the Upsala Golf International on the Challenge Tour in 1992 and 1993. The event was introduced in 1996 as one of four new tournaments alongside Toyota Ladies Open, Öijared Ladies Open and Delsjö Ladies Open (last played in 1988).

At the final event in 1998 Marie Hedberg won while still a student at San Jose State, but narrowly lost out on the Player of the Year title to runner-up Nina Karlsson. (en)
